Rax200 firmware update V1.0.2.8_1.0.45 causes the router to go offline every few hours
I just updated my Rax200 router with the firmware update V.1.0.2.8_1.0.45 this morning. It has lost connection to the internet 4 times so far today. The Netgear CM1100 connected by an Ethernet cable seems to remain on line and connected to Comcast. But the router indicates it is not connected to the internet via a wired connection, I believe it did not allow me to connect wirelessly with a new connection when this occured. The Nighthawk IPHONE app would not connect to the router either, Powering down the router and waiting corrected the problem, as well doing a reset via Routerlogin via a wired connection fixes the problem. I suspect there is something unstable in the firmware that looses connection with the cable modem and wireless devices. This expensive a Router should not have problems like this crop up. I have checked for new firmware in the routerlogin connection but none has shown up yet, 6:30 PM PST 3/24/20.
